AI-Powered Project Scheduling & Planning

AI analyzes historical project data, weather patterns, and resource availability to generate optimized construction schedules. Machine learning models predict delays before they happen and suggest resource reallocation in real-time.

  • Predictive scheduling that adjusts automatically when materials or labor are delayed
  • Resource optimization across multiple concurrent job sites
  • Weather-aware timeline adjustments with 14-day forecast integration
  • Automated critical path analysis with what-if scenario modeling

AI in BIM & Design Automation

Building Information Modeling (BIM) enhanced with AI automates clash detection, structural analysis, and code compliance checks. Generative design algorithms produce optimized structural layouts that reduce material waste by 15-30%.

  • Automated clash detection between structural, MEP, and architectural models
  • Generative design for structural optimization and material reduction
  • AI code compliance checking against local building regulations
  • 4D simulation linking BIM models to construction schedules

AI Safety Monitoring & Compliance

Computer vision systems monitor job sites in real-time, detecting safety violations like missing PPE, unsafe worker positioning, or unauthorized site access. AI reduces workplace incidents by up to 40% in early-adopter studies.

  • Real-time PPE detection (helmets, vests, harnesses) via site cameras
  • Geofencing for hazardous area alerts and exclusion zone enforcement
  • Automated incident reporting with video evidence tagging
  • Fatigue and behavior pattern analysis for high-risk alerts

AI Cost Estimation & Quantity Takeoff

AI-powered estimation tools analyze blueprints and specifications to generate accurate quantity takeoffs and cost estimates in minutes instead of days. Historical cost data enables ±3% accuracy on early-stage estimates.

  • Automated quantity takeoff from 2D drawings and 3D BIM models
  • Market-adjusted material pricing using real-time supplier data
  • Labor cost estimation with regional wage database integration
  • Change order impact analysis with automated budget re-forecasting

AI for Construction Supply Chain & Logistics

AI optimizes material procurement, delivery scheduling, and inventory management across job sites. Predictive models forecast material shortages and suggest alternative suppliers before delays impact the critical path.

  • Just-in-time material delivery scheduling coordinated with site readiness
  • Supplier risk scoring based on historical performance and financial health
  • Inventory optimization across multiple active projects
  • Automated purchase order generation with compliance checks

Top AI Tools for Construction

Leading AI tools used by construction firms, civil engineers, and project managers.

Design & BIM

Autodesk Forma

AI-powered early-stage design and analysis for building performance

Revit + Dynamo

Parametric BIM with AI-driven design automation scripts

BricsCAD BIM

AI-assisted BIM modeling with intelligent object recognition

Project Management

Procore AI

AI-enhanced construction management with predictive scheduling

Oracle Aconex

Intelligent project controls with AI-driven risk detection

PlanGrid (Autodesk)

AI-powered field management and blueprint markup

Safety & Compliance

Smartvid.io

AI video analytics for job site safety and productivity

Doxel

Computer vision progress tracking and quality inspection

Buildots

AI site monitoring comparing as-built vs design models

Estimation & Cost Control

Bluebeam Revu + AI

AI-assisted quantity takeoff and markup

ConstructConnect

AI-powered cost estimating with market data

Beck Technology Destini

AI-driven conceptual estimating and benchmarking
